What Are People Taking Instead of Energy Drinks for Lasting Energy?

In today’s fast-paced world, energy drinks have become a popular go-to solution for many seeking a quick boost. However, an increasing number of people are turning away from these sugar-laden, caffeine-packed beverages in search of healthier, more sustainable alternatives for lasting energy. This shift stems from growing awareness of health issues associated with energy drinks, such as anxiety, sleep disturbances, and even heart complications. As individuals strive for a more balanced approach to energy enhancement, several alternatives have emerged, proving effective without the infamous jitters and crashes.

One popular alternative is a focus on whole foods that provide natural energy. Complex carbohydrates, such as whole grains, oats, and sweet potatoes, are excellent sources. They offer a steady release of energy, unlike the quick rush derived from refined sugars. Additionally, foods rich in healthy fats, such as avocados, nuts, and seeds, help maintain energy levels throughout the day. Incorporating protein sources like eggs, legumes, and lean meats can also stabilize blood sugar levels, allowing for sustained energy without the peaks and troughs associated with energy drinks.

Another growing trend is the use of herbal teas and infusions. Certain herbs such as ginseng, matcha, and peppermint are famed for their energizing properties. Ginseng, for instance, is believed to enhance physical performance and reduce fatigue, while matcha, a powdered form of green tea, provides a gentler caffeine boost along with an array of antioxidants. Peppermint tea is noted not just for its refreshing taste; its aroma can help invigorate the mind, keeping you alert and focused.

Hydration is another key factor in maintaining lasting energy. Dehydration can lead to fatigue and decreased cognitive function, making water intake vital. While plain water is sufficient in many cases, some find that adding electrolytes through natural sources like coconut water or homemade electrolyte drinks can further boost energy levels. These options not only hydrate but also replenish essential minerals that maintain bodily functions and enhance stamina.

Physical activity is also a powerful, natural way to combat fatigue and increase energy. Engaging in regular exercise releases endorphins, which improve mood and create a sense of vitality. Activities like brisk walking, cycling, or even a short workout can invigorate your body and mind. Moreover, incorporating flexibility and strength training can contribute to better overall energy management.

Lastly, mental health practices such as mindfulness and adequate sleep are essential components of sustained energy. Stress management techniques like meditation, yoga, or breathing exercises can significantly reduce fatigue levels. Ensuring you get restorative sleep each night sets the foundation for a day filled with energy. Sleep hygiene, including creating a bedtime routine and limiting screen time before bed, can lead to better sleep quality.
